Unocal

For years, unocal has been tagged as an underachiever, as its oil and gas results trailed the industry. No more. Thanks to big new fields coming on line in Azerbaijan, the Gulf of Mexico, and Bangladesh, Unocal is expected to boost production by 4% this year, while most big oil companies remain stagnant. With oil prices surging, the El Segundo (Calif.) company saw earnings leap 64% in the past year. Those lucrative offshore reserves have made Unocal a frequently mentioned takeover target. That's a big reason its stock has returned a hefty 45.2% over the past 12 months.

Company Snapshot

Unocal Corporation engages in the exploration, development, and production of natural gas, crude oil, condensate, and natural gas liquids, with principal operations in North America and Asia. It operates in three segments: Exploration and Production, Midstream and Marketing, and Geothermal. Exploration and Production segment engages the exploration, development, and production of oil and gas. It’s proved oil and gas reserves were 1.754 billion barrels of oil equivalent, as of December 31, 2004. It also operated 10,436 oil and gas producing wells, as of the above date. Midstream and Marketing segment consists of the company's equity interests in petroleum pipeline companies, wholly owned pipelines, and terminals in the United States; the North America gas storage business; and the transporting and selling of hydrocarbon. The Geothermal segment produces geothermal steam for power generation. The company also operates geothermal steam-fired power plants in Indonesia and has equity interests in gas-fired power plants in Thailand. Unocal Corporation was incorporated in 1983 and is headquartered in El Segundo, California.
